Home Drainage Installation in Birmingham, AL
Home drainage installation services involve designing and setting up systems to effectively manage excess water around a property. These services typically cover projects such as installing new drain pipes, French drains, surface drains, or sump pump systems to prevent water accumulation in yards, basements, or foundations. Property owners often seek these services when experiencing issues with standing water, soil erosion, or basement flooding, especially after heavy rains or during periods of rapid snowmelt. Understanding the scope of drainage solutions and the specific needs of a property can help homeowners ensure their landscape remains dry and stable.
Before requesting home drainage installation, property owners should consider factors such as the layout of their land, existing drainage problems, and the desired outcomes for water management. It’s important to evaluate the property's grading, soil type, and proximity to drainage outlets or natural water sources. Clear communication about the location of problem areas and future plans for landscaping or construction can assist in designing an effective drainage system. Proper planning ensures the installed drainage solutions will effectively protect the home and yard from water-related issues.

Common Home Drainage Installation Jobs
French Drain Installation - effective for redirecting surface water away from foundations.
Sump Pump Systems - designed to remove excess water from basements and crawl spaces.
Drainage Pipe Installation - helps manage water flow around property landscapes.
Catch Basin Setup - prevents standing water and reduces flooding risks.
Grading and Sloping - improves drainage by directing water away from structures.
Erosion Control Solutions - stabilizes soil and prevents water-related damage on slopes.
Home Drainage Installation Questions
What is home drainage installation? It involves setting up systems to direct excess water away from a property’s foundation, preventing water damage and flooding.
When should property owners consider drainage installation? When there are signs of poor drainage, such as pooling water, foundation issues, or erosion around the yard.
What types of drainage systems are commonly installed? Popular options include French drains, surface drains, and sump pump systems tailored to specific property needs.
How does proper drainage benefit a home? It helps protect the foundation, reduces water-related damage, and maintains a dry, safe outdoor environment.
